Output bb51b28e53445802c357e0e893bc1be36620e0ebc73f92e2c42e94cd9b0571a6:1

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b275024429bff59d79d736fc8b6418897767512c OP_EQUAL
address
3HxcNcAnSQEm4kKUznfPfZpn821dGhEwHr
transaction
bb51b28e53445802c357e0e893bc1be36620e0ebc73f92e2c42e94cd9b0571a6
confirmations
525146
spent
true